Napa Valley’s Darioush Winery produces bold, expressive, elevated Cabernet Sauvignon wines with character. Still, the winemaking prowess does not stop there, as is evident in its luscious, well-rounded, and highly appealing Viognier. Darioush Signature Viognier uses fruit grown in the Oak Knoll AVA, a slightly cooler location towards the southern part of Napa, ensuring delicate fruit remains fresh and bright throughout the growing season.
With lovely aromas of peach blossom, ripe apricot, and citrus, the wine invites you in to enjoy a glass, revealing layers of orchard fruit, a hint of spice, and a creamy, well-rounded palate. Enjoy this beauty from now through the fall, as its palate is light enough to enjoy with fresh summer fare and slightly richer dishes that come when temperatures begin to drop. We suggest seared scallops, grilled shrimp, or Asian fare like a light Thai curry.
